American Idol: Nepali singer Dibesh Pokharel appeals for votes for 10 finalists



KATHMANDU: Nepali youth singer Dibesh Pokharel (Arthur Gunn) has appealed for votes to reach the top 10 finalists in the American Idol.

With the premier show performance on Sunday, the voting for the reality show has started.

Posting a message on his Instagram, Dibesh has appealed to one and all for votes to get through the elimination round. Top 10 finalists will be selected out of 20 contestants through votes.

“I would like to thank you all for helping me all through by casting votes. The premier show is taking place on Sunday for the American Idol. This is an elimination round.  I need your votes to get through this round,” reads his Instagram post.

People can vote him through text messages, website and American Idol app and one can vote up to 30 times.

The reality show is bringing out its program amidst Coronavirus pandemic that has wreaked havoc across the world. The contestants get connected through their respective homes themselves.
